Learning About England (from Jan 2011)

Like I told y'all I went through the 7 and 1/2 grade in school. And I also told y'all to recognize the difference in being ignorant and being stupid. I ain't learned all I need to learn, but I think I got a lot of common sense. Right now I do need to learn a lot about England.

One thing I figured out right off the bat was what this joke I heard meant just from reading them leaflets. The joke was why did the Siamese twins go to England? The answer: So the other one could drive. You see I was ignorant of the idea that those people over there drive on the wrong side of the road. It sure wasn't stupid not to know this. Who in his right mind would have guessed such a thing? So I am ahead of the game by reading them leaflets and books what Hollis brung to me. I figure I can learn enough right here in Harper; so I won't need to go all the way over there. Hollis says it ain't the same. Going is so much better. Well, I just as soon to have read about how cold it was in Korea and stayed at home by the fire. Something else I learned: Big Ben ain't no clock. It's a bell. You see what I mean. It wasn't stupid not to know that. Just a little ignorance.
